Everyone and their Mom seems to be filing for a bitcoin ETF in the US. Is it really going to happen soon?
It may seem so, but as far as I can see there are currently only 8 applications pending consideration by the SEC - with CBOE-VanEck's first application being rejected (extended) at first and as always a decision is likely to be made after 240 days. - which means that the final decision will be made at the end of this year.
Judging by the comments of various experts, many agree that it is much more realistic to approve the first such ETF in the US perhaps only in 2022 or later - because much of why the SEC refuses to make a positive decision has not yet been resolved - with an emphasis on market manipulation presents a major problem.
